Arrests reported as RCMP move to clear Wet’suwet’en pipeline resistance in B.C. for 3rd time

Wet'suwet'en

The RCMP moved in Thursday morning to clear a forest service road in northern British Columbia that was barricaded as Wet’suwet’en and Haudenesaunee members prepared for a “final stand” to block construction of a multibillion-dollar natural gas pipeline.

Canadian women’s soccer team looks to extend unbeaten run with 2 games in Mexico

priestman-bev-111821

The Canadian women will look to extend their 12-game unbeaten run with a pair of games in Mexico. Sixth-ranked Canada will play No. 28 Mexico on Nov. 27 and Nov. 30 with a 10-day camp starting Nov. 22 in Mexico City.

2 B.C. doctors linked to website selling bogus mask and vaccine exemption ‘certificates’

EnableAir.com

A B.C. physician accused of spreading misinformation about COVID-19 is now under investigation for allegedly writing phoney mask and vaccine exemptions offered through a Kelowna-based website. That website, EnableAir.com, appears to be connected to another B.C. doctor.
